Merge lp:~ivaldi/midori/fix-1185895 into lp:midori

Proposed by André Stösel
Status: Merged
Approved by: Paweł Forysiuk
Approved revision: 6183
Merged at revision: 6188
Proposed branch: lp:~ivaldi/midori/fix-1185895
Merge into: lp:midori
Diff against target: 26 lines (+4/-5)
1 file modified
midori/midori-view.c (+4/-5)
To merge this branch: bzr merge lp:~ivaldi/midori/fix-1185895
Reviewer Review Type Date Requested Status
Paweł Forysiuk Approve
gue5t gue5t Approve
Review via email: mp+166727@code.launchpad.net

Commit message

Fix memory leak introduced in r6184

To post a comment you must log in.
Revision history for this message
gue5t gue5t (gue5t) wrote :

Looks good.

review: Approve
Revision history for this message
Paweł Forysiuk (tuxator) :
review: Approve

Preview Diff

[H/L] Next/Prev Comment, [J/K] Next/Prev File, [N/P] Next/Prev Hunk
1=== modified file 'midori/midori-view.c'
2--- midori/midori-view.c 2013-05-30 16:40:15 +0000
3+++ midori/midori-view.c 2013-05-31 09:42:49 +0000
4@@ -1814,10 +1814,6 @@
5 if (gtk_widget_get_window (view->web_view))
6 {
7
8- if (!event) {
9- event = (GdkEventButton *)gtk_get_current_event();
10- }
11-
12 if (x != NULL)
13 *x = event->x;
14 if (y != NULL)
15@@ -2608,7 +2604,10 @@
16 gboolean is_image;
17 gboolean is_media;
18
19- midori_view_ensure_link_uri (view, &x, &y, NULL);
20+ GdkEvent* event = gtk_get_current_event();
21+ midori_view_ensure_link_uri (view, &x, &y, (GdkEventButton *)event);
22+ gdk_event_free (event);
23+
24 context = katze_object_get_int (view->hit_test, "context");
25 has_selection = context & WEBKIT_HIT_TEST_RESULT_CONTEXT_SELECTION;
26 /* Ensure view->selected_text */

Subscribers

People subscribed via source and target branches

to all changes: